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
387196 33001200608 16320854868 3224720 0693
593338 0023311
593338 0023311
241359 9589 1041377385 7981673 2983295
All about undefined
Interested in learning more?
593338 0023311
241359 9589 1041377385 7981673 2983295
See more
3736696 2877
08318704 7432791 5630206654
See more
049575 7221 484608766
63 6596 956 2812
See more